    G.W. Lycett, D. Grierson.
    Summary: A publication comprised of various papers on the subject of genetic engineering in crop plants. Topics covered include plant genetic manipulation, modulation of plant gene expression and genetic engineering of crops for insect resistance using genes of plant origin.
